4.2 Connecting the Welder:

  1. Connect the MIG Welding Torch to the appropriate port on the front panel.
  2. Attach the Ground Clamp to the workpiece or welding table, ensuring good electrical contact.
  3. For Stick welding, connect the Electronic Holder to the positive terminal and the Ground Clamp zuwa m tashar.
  4. For Lift TIG welding, connect the TIG torch (sold separately) to the appropriate terminal and the Ground Clamp zuwa m tashar.

4.3 Installing Flux-Cored Wire (for MIG Gasless):

The welder features a stable and smooth wire feed structure.

  1. Bude sashin ciyarwar waya.
  2. Place the 0.5kg flux-cored wire spool onto the spindle.
  3. Thread the wire through the wire pressing wheel and into the automatic wire feed mechanism.
  4. Ensure the wire feeding wheel is correctly sized for the 0.8mm flux-cored wire. The welder supports 0.030" (0.8mm), 0.035" (0.9mm), and 0.040" (1.0mm) flux core wire sizes.
  5. Rufe sashin.

5.1 Gasless MIG Welding:

This mode is ideal for welding stainless steel, carbon steel, and thicker steel without the need for external shielding gas, using flux-cored wire.

  1. Ensure flux-cored wire is correctly installed (refer to Section 4.3).
  2. Select "MIG Gasless" mode on the control panel.
  3. Adjust current and voltage settings as required for your material thickness. The machine provides clear digital readouts.
  4. Begin welding, maintaining a consistent travel speed and arc length.

5.2 Stick (MMA) Welding:

For stick welding, ensure the electronic holder and ground clamp are connected as described in Section 4.2.

  1. Insert the appropriate electrode into the electronic holder.
  2. Select "Stick/MMA/ARC" mode on the control panel.
  3. Adjust the current (amperage) according to the electrode type and material thickness.
  4. Strike an arc and maintain a consistent arc length and travel speed for optimal results.

5.3 Lift TIG Welding:

For Lift TIG welding, an additional Lift TIG torch is required (sold separately). This mode provides precise control for delicate welding tasks.

  1. Connect the Lift TIG torch and ensure proper tungsten electrode installation.
  2. Select "Lift TIG" mode on the control panel.
  3. Adjust current settings.
  4. Initiate the arc by gently touching the tungsten to the workpiece and lifting slightly.

7. Shirya matsala

This section addresses common issues you might encounter with your FLARING 155Amp MIG Welder.

MatsalaDalili mai yiwuwaMagani
Babu iko ga naúrar.Power cord unplugged, circuit breaker tripped, faulty power switch.Check power connections, reset circuit breaker, contact support if switch is faulty.
Poor arc starting or unstable arc.Improper ground connection, incorrect settings, worn contact tip (MIG), damp electrodes (Stick).Ensure solid ground connection, adjust current/voltage, replace contact tip, dry electrodes.
Wire feeding issues (MIG).Incorrect wire tension, clogged liner, wrong contact tip size, tangled wire spool.Adjust wire tension, clean/replace liner, use correct contact tip, untangle wire.
Overheat indicator (ER) on.Exceeded duty cycle, insufficient ventilation.Allow the machine to cool down, ensure clear airflow around the unit.
